## Deployment

Heads up: the relevance tuning for Quillfind ships as config, not code, so a redeploy isn't always needed — but a cache flush is. The Bramleigh cluster caches boost weights for an hour. When cutting a release, double-check the synonym pack version too. The active tuning values are listed below.

deployment values, tagug-tagaf:
[zorix]
team = druix
access_code = ac_42e3e2
host = zorix.qirvancorp.test
port = 6379
owner = beldor.gordor
peer = kelath.zemvarcorp.test

Handing over the Quillcache bloom filter that fronts our key-value store. It cuts ~70% of lookups for absent keys. Main gotcha: the filter is rebuilt nightly, and deletes aren't reflected until then, so expect some false positives late in the day. Sizing math, rebuild schedule, and the regeneration procedure are written up here:

wiki page, tahaf-tajog: https://jira.ordindyn.corp/pipeline

Subject: Cut-over complete — Spokewise rebalancer

Cut-over of the Spokewise rebalancing tool finished at 02:40. Old scheduler drained, new truck-routing engine took full traffic in the Halloran Bay zone. One hiccup: stale dock-capacity cache, flushed manually. No missed rebalance windows. Rollback window closes Friday; keep the old queue warm until then. Metrics dashboards updated. Sign-off needed from you before we decommission the legacy nodes. For the record, the production configuration now in effect is below.

settings of fafog-haduf:
ZORIX_PIN=4648
ZORIX_METRICS_HOST=metrics.zorix.paliqsys.corp
ZORIX_LOG_LEVEL=info
ZORIX_TENANT=druix

# Build Provenance: Quillcast Log Sampling

Quick notes for the weekly sync. Quillcast's firehose service was drowning Stackpond, so sampling (1:25 on debug, 1:5 on info) now ships baked into each build rather than as runtime config. Why? So we can prove exactly which sampling rules were active for any given artifact. Every Quillcast build page links its sampling manifest plus provenance attestation. To verify a deployed artifact, match it against the token shown below.

session token of kahif-kageg = htk14_01cd78718aea51